In today’s competitive job market, employer branding plays a pivotal role in attracting and retaining talent. This article will delve into the significance of employer branding and how it influences recruitment strategies.
Employer branding refers to a company’s reputation as a place to work and its value proposition to employees. A strong employer brand can enhance your organization’s ability to attract high-quality candidates and reduce turnover rates.
Transparency, company culture, and employee engagement are critical components of a successful employer brand. Highlighting your organization’s values and mission can help potential applicants resonate with your brand.
Companies with a positive employer brand often receive more applications, allowing them to be more selective during the hiring process. Additionally, a well-established employer brand can lead to cost savings in recruitment by reducing time spent on interviews and onboarding.
Regularly engage with employees and gather feedback to understand their experiences. Showcase these testimonials on your website and social media platforms to build authenticity. Furthermore, foster a positive work environment that aligns with your brand values.
In conclusion, investing in employer branding is crucial for successful recruitment. By cultivating a strong brand identity, companies can attract top talent and create a vibrant workplace culture.
